Title: Innovations by Shinji Ono in Radiation Detection
Introduction
Shinji Ono is a notable inventor based in Honjo,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of radiation detection, holding a total of 2 patents. His work focuses on improving the efficiency and reliability of radiation detecting devices and systems.
Latest Patents
Ono's latest patents include a radiation detecting device and a radiation detecting system, along with a method for manufacturing the radiation detecting device. The radiation detecting device aims to reduce defective adhesion between an adhesive member and the end portions of multiple sensor substrates. This device features several sensor substrates arranged adjacent to each other, each equipped with photoelectric converting elements. Additionally, a scintillator is positioned alongside the first surfaces of these sensor substrates, with a sheet-like adhesive member ensuring a strong bond between the substrates and the scintillator.
Another significant patent is the radiation imaging apparatus and radiation imaging system. This apparatus is designed to sense radiation images and includes a radiation imaging panel with multiple imaging substrates and a scintillator. The housing of the apparatus is structured to support the scintillator effectively, ensuring optimal performance in radiation imaging.
Career Highlights
Shinji Ono is currently employed at Canon Kabushiki Kaisha, a leading company in imaging and optical products. His work at Canon has allowed him to focus on innovative solutions in radiation detection technology.
Collaborations
Ono has collaborated with talented coworkers such as Takamasa Ishii and Kota Nishibe. Their combined expertise has contributed to the advancement of radiation detection technologies.
